‘Have irrefutable evidence that Indian MiG-21 shot down Pakistani F-16’, says IAF, shows radar images as proof

The Indian Air Force (IAF) briefed the press today in response to claims by Pakistani Prime Minister Imran Khan that one of their F-16 jets wasn’t shot down by Wing Commander Abhinandan based on a dubious report.

Following the report by Foreign Policy, many Indian media outlets, with a hostile disposition towards the Modi government, lapped it up and used it to ridicule the government over the claims made by it regarding the downing of a Pakistani Falcon by an Indian MiG-21 Bison.


The IAF today stated, “One Mig 21 Bison of the IAF piloted by Wg Cdr Abhinandan shot down one F-16 of PAF. The F-16 crashed and fell across the LOC in PO J&K.” “The IAF has irrefutable evidence of not only the fact that F-16 was used by PAF on 27Feb19 but also that an IAF Mig21 Bison shot down a PAF F-16,” it added.

The IAF stated further, “The Indian Army posts in the vicinity of the LOC in the Jhangar sector (under Nowshera Brigade) have visually sighted two separate parachutes.” Comments made by the DG-ISPR and radio communications intercepts of Pakistan Army formations in the area were also cited to validate their observations in addition to radar images.

“In his initial statement on 27Feb19 DG ISPR categorically said ‘3 pilots – one in custody, two in the area’. Subsequently, DG ISPR also stated on camera in a press conference that they had two pilots. One in custody and the other had been admitted to hospital and was being given treatment. The same was further corroborated by the statement by the Pak PM on camera also indicating more than one pilot,” the statement said.

“There is no doubt that two aircraft went down in the aerial engagement on 27Feb19 one of which was a Bison of IAF while the other was F-16 of PAF conclusively identified by its electronic signature and radio transcripts,” the statement read.” The IAF has “more credible information and evidence” to prove the fact but is choosing not to do so due to “security and confidentiality concerns”.

The IAF also said in its statement that it has “achieved its objectives of successfully striking the terrorist camp at Balakot and thwarting the PAF attack against our military installations” while “PAF was unable to achieve its military objectives”.

UK court denies Vijay Mallya permission to appeal against his extradition to India

In the latest development in the extradition process of Vijay Mallya to India, a UK High Court on Monday denied permission to appeal against the extradition order. The development comes after he offered to cut down his expenses to pay back debt his defunct Kingfisher Airlines owes banks in India. Vijay Mallya had sought to appeal against his extradition order issued by the UK government, after getting the go-ahead from the Westminster Magistrates’ Court.


A spokesperson for the UK judiciary said that “the application for permission to appeal was refused by Mr Justice William Davis on 05/04/2019.” The spokesperson added that “the appellant (Mallya) has five business days to apply for oral consideration. If a renewal application is made, it will be listed before a High Court judge and dealt with at a hearing.”

The single judge court rejected permission for appeal based on papers submitted with the application.

Now that Mallya’s application has been rejected by Judge Davis, he has the option to submit for a “renewal”. The renewal process will lead to a brief oral hearing, which will include representations from the sides, Vijay Mallya and Crown Prosecution Service (CPS) on behalf of the Indian government. This process will determine whether the appeal can go for a full hearing.

The State Bank of India, which lent £1.142 billion ($1.5 billion) to Mallya for his now defunct Kingfisher Airlines, has been reassured by his lawyers that their client is willing to curb his spending to £29,500 a month, SBI’s lawyers told a London court on Wednesday. He is currently spending about £18,300 a week.

Mallya is facing criminal charges of money laundering, fraud, and violation of the Foreign Exchange Management Act (FEMA).  Mallya has now the option to appeal to the Supreme Court which may take at least another six weeks.
